LOS ANGELES, CALIFORNIA: In a recent segment on Fox News, Maria Bartiromo stirred controversy by suggesting that former President Barack Obama might be orchestrating a scheme to replace Joe Biden as the Democratic nominee for the upcoming presidential election.

During her conversation with RNC co-chair Lara Trump, Bartiromo speculated on the possibility of Biden being sidelined and raised questions about the role of Democratic superdelegates in such a scenario.

Maria Bartiromo and Lara Trump discuss potential democratic maneuvers

Bartiromo posed the provocative question, "Well, I mean, what about the superdelegates? Right? And all the delegates that have been secured? Does President Obama run that?" This inquiry implies a belief that Obama could wield considerable influence behind the scenes, potentially influencing party decisions critical to Biden's candidacy.

She further probed, "How do you get the superdelegates to agree to make a change?" hinting at the complexity and secrecy she perceives in any move to alter the Democratic ticket.



 

Lara Trump joined in, emphasizing the magnitude of the issue, remarking, "It's a huge question. I'm sure they're scrambling. I'm sure they're having late-night sessions trying to figure out how to salvage this." Her comments echo concerns within some conservative circles about the perceived instability or dissatisfaction with Biden's leadership.

Amid the speculation, both Bartiromo and Lara appeared confident in the reelection prospects of former President Donald Trump. "And no matter how they try and spin it, no matter what they try and do, I think that it's going to be a resounding win again for Donald Trump in November," Lara asserted, to which Bartiromo enthusiastically agreed, "Yeah."
